MySQL 5.6是MySQL数据库管理系统的一个重要版本,它在2013年发布,带来了许多性能提升和新特性。本文将详细介绍MySQL 5.6的安装过程,以及该版本的一些核心特点。
让我们从安装步骤开始。安装MySQL 5.6通常包括以下几个关键环节:
1. **下载安装包**:你已经拥有名为"mysql5.6最新安装版本"的压缩包,这包含了安装MySQL 5.6所需的所有文件。你需要先解压缩这个文件,通常会得到一个可执行的安装程序。
2. **系统需求**:在安装前,确保你的操作系统满足MySQL 5.6的最低硬件和软件要求。通常,这包括足够的内存(至少1GB)、兼容的操作系统(如Windows、Linux或macOS)以及支持的处理器。
3. **安装过程**:运行解压后的安装程序,按照向导提示进行。你需要选择安装类型,通常有“Typical”(标准),“Developer”(开发者)和“Custom”(自定义)等选项。对于大多数用户,"Typical"设置就足够了。
4. **配置服务器**:在安装过程中,会有一个配置步骤,你可以设置服务器类型(如开发服务器、生产服务器或多用途服务器),以及选择是否启用TCP/IP网络连接,设置端口号(默认为3306),以及设置root用户的密码。
5. **启动服务**:安装完成后,MySQL服务会自动启动。你可以通过服务管理工具或命令行检查MySQL服务状态,并进行启动、停止和重启操作。
接下来,我们探讨MySQL 5.6的一些关键特性:
1. **性能提升**:MySQL 5.6引入了InnoDB存储引擎的并行插入,提高了写入速度。此外,查询优化器也得到了改进,能更好地处理复杂查询。
2. **全文搜索**:MySQL 5.6增强了全文索引功能,支持更多语言的分词,并可以进行模糊匹配和排序。
3. **复制改进**:复制功能在5.6版本中有所增强,支持半同步复制,确保数据在主从服务器间的同步性。
4. **分区表**:在5.6版本中,分区表的性能得到了优化,支持更多的分区策略,如线性哈希分区。
5. **存储过程和触发器**:MySQL 5.6增强了存储过程和触发器的性能,使其更适应复杂的业务逻辑。
6. **性能监控**:新的Performance Schema提供了丰富的性能监控和分析工具,帮助管理员诊断和优化数据库性能。
7. **安全性**:增强了身份验证和授权机制,支持更安全的加密算法,并提供了更好的审计功能。
8. **在线DDL**:MySQL 5.6支持在线数据定义语言(DDL),这意味着在修改表结构时,数据库服务可以保持在线,减少了维护窗口。
MySQL 5.6是一个功能强大且稳定的版本,它的改进使得数据库管理更加高效,性能更加出色。对于需要稳定数据库服务的企业和开发者来说,这是一个值得选择的版本。在实际使用中,确保熟悉这些特性和安装流程,能更好地利用MySQL 5.6的优势来满足业务需求。